Court Denies Anticipatory Bail for Petitioner in Fictitious Firm Fraud Case; Custodial Interrogation Deemed Necessary for Investigation.

....Seeking grant of Anticipatory bail - In fact he and his co-accused had set up a fictitious firm/companies and thereby cheated the government of crores of rupees. Thus, an offence is prima facie established against him. Even otherwise, recoveries of various documents are to be effected from the petitioner and the names of the real beneficiaries are to be revealed. Therefore, the custodial interrogation of the petitioner is certainly required. - HC....
